620. Deputy Barry Cowen asked the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port the breakdown of the €75 million allocation for 2019 for the heavy rail enhancement programme; the date in 2019 the city centre resignaling project is expected to be completed; the date in 2019 the Pearse Street re-roofing will commence; if it will be impacted by the cost overrun with the national children's hospital; if he or his officials have been consulted by the Department of Public Expenditure and Reform in this regard;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[6882/19]
